Security

A shiny new phone system chock-full of features is just not worth the investment if it’s not secure. VoIP usually comes with standard security features including caller ID, password authentication, password lockout, encryption, and more. What’s more, calls are automatically encrypted to prevent anyone from listening in on private conversations.

VoIP systems also have failover solutions in emergency cases, such as office power outages. Should this happen, calls can be forwarded to mobile phones, laptops, and other devices automatically.

Mobility

The ability to reach out to your clients, even if you don’t have a phone on you, is a must-have. A VoIP phone system allows you to make and receive calls through applications. You just need a computer with a quality microphone, headset, and a stable internet connection, and you’re good to go. Or you can use a smartphone application to easily make, receive and transfer calls through the phone system.

VoIP allows your workforce greater flexibility to be mobile. Wherever your staff members are, they can still work as if they never left the office.

Affordability

Sending voice data over the internet is much cheaper. Businesses can save up to 75 percent when they switch from making landline calls to making calls from VoIP phones.

Traditional landlines require large and lengthy copper cables to transmit voice across distances, adding up expenses that are passed on to consumers. But VoIP uses the Internet. There are no hidden surcharges for calls, and adding phone lines is as simple as creating a new email account.

VoIP also reduces your monthly costs. Your company spends less for office supplies, utilities, and staff expenditure, if your employees work from home or any other location of their choosing.
